1999 A GREAT YEAR FOR BILLION-DOLLAR CLUB

The Billion-Dollar Club finished strong, up 6.6%. Its peer, the S & P; 500 was up 1.9%. The OC 100 was the only index down, falling 0.2%. The Russell 2000 was up 4.0%, while the Dow finished up 2.5%. Centris Group Inc. dropped off the OC 100. The company was acquired by Houston-based HCC Insurance Holdings Inc. Debuting in the OC 100 is Garden Grove-based Bridge Technology, up 37.5%; Bridge is also one of the week’s best performers. The week’s worst performer was STM Wireless, down 18.8%, after spiking 49% the prior week on no news. Also down 18.8% is PharmaPrint Inc. on no corporate news.

The cover story in the Dec. 29 issue of Forbes lays out a pretty picture for real estate investment trusts (REITs) and points out several that have been very busy in the OC market. “The unstoppable REIT juggernaut,” goes the story’s headline, and a kicker goes even further: “Forget industrial stocks,” it advises. “For the next few years, real estate is where the action will be.” Among the players that have stirred OC’s market lately is Newport Beach-based LBA Properties Inc., which is poised for an IPO and just saw Boston-based AEW Capital Management make a sizeable investment. El Segundo-based Kilroy Corp. (NYSE, KRC), which has been gobbling up office and industrial space throughout OC was lauded by authors Robert Lezner and Carrie Shook for its recent purchase of the Allen Group, which gives it about 10% of the north suburban San Diego office market. Kilroy in mid-1997 paid $43.6 for Mission Land Co.’s portfolio of land and buildings in OC. And Menlo Park, Calif.-based Spieker Properties (NYSE, SPK), which is in escrow with its proposed purchase of The City Tower in Orange and has expressed interests the Unocal 76 building in Costs Mesa. Forbes points out that just five years ago all REITs in the U.S. combined for a market value of just $10 billion. That’s gone to current level of $142 billion and is expected to grow further. Market pros like the plays. “If you own real estate in California in the next two years you’re going to do very, very well,” Prudential Securities senior analyst Louis Taylor told Forbes.

The challenges for Stanton-based auto aftermarket company Boyds Wheels Inc. (BYDS, NASDAQ), according to Cruttenden Roth: Boyd Coddington resigned recently, the company has lost $7.7 million through the first three quarters, and sales have remained below levels that would make a recent increase in capacity begin paying off. Cruttenden analyst William Gibson says Boyds still has a viable brand name but will need additional capital to leverage that. Cruttenden gave Boyds issues a “neutral” rating.
